Javascript 单击“删除”按钮时如何删除iframe
我有一个脚本,如果你把它放在你的网站上,它会插入iframe到你的网站 iframe调用测验网页此测验页面将位于您的网站上方,如果您正确回答测验,则应删除测验页面。。所以我做了所有的事情,但我不能在他完成问题后删除iframe以查看原始网站 这是我想要的样品 我有两页,第一页是父母,第二页是孩子 我想知道当我单击子页面内的按钮时如何删除iframe 母公司Javascript 单击“删除”按钮时如何删除iframe,javascript,jquery,iframe,Javascript,Jquery,Iframe,我有一个脚本,如果你把它放在你的网站上,它会插入iframe到你的网站 iframe调用测验网页此测验页面将位于您的网站上方,如果您正确回答测验,则应删除测验页面。。所以我做了所有的事情,但我不能在他完成问题后删除iframe以查看原始网站 这是我想要的样品 我有两页,第一页是父母,第二页是孩子 我想知道当我单击子页面内的按钮时如何删除iframe 母公司 父母亲 在注释中,您的函数仅在onload中可见。 试试这个: 函数myFunction(){ var getframe=docu
父母亲
在注释中,您的函数仅在onload中可见。
试试这个:
函数myFunction(){
var getframe=document.getElementById(“frame”);
getframe.innerHTML='';
}
函数delFrame(){
var getframe=document.getElementById(“frame”);
getframe.remove();
}
函数hideFrame(){
var getframe=document.getElementById(“frame”);
getframe.style.display='none';
}
函数showFrame(){
var getframe=document.getElementById(“frame”);
getframe.style.display='block';
}
window.onload=函数(){
myFunction();
}
点击我
删除帧
隐藏框架
展示架
在注释中,您的函数仅在onload中可见。
试试这个:
函数myFunction(){
var getframe=document.getElementById(“frame”);
getframe.innerHTML='';
}
函数delFrame(){
var getframe=document.getElementById(“frame”);
getframe.remove();
}
函数hideFrame(){
var getframe=document.getElementById(“frame”);
getframe.style.display='none';
}
函数showFrame(){
var getframe=document.getElementById(“frame”);
getframe.style.display='block';
}
window.onload=函数(){
myFunction();
}
点击我
删除帧
隐藏框架
展示架
您的函数myFunction
无法全局访问,因为它是onload
函数的一部分。您是否尝试过将其移动到
的顶部?我尝试过,我发现此错误无法设置Null的属性“innerHTML”其目的是从子级执行js,而不是从父级执行js我更新了帖子,您是否可以再次看到它您的函数myFunction
无法全局访问,因为它是onload
函数的一部分。您是否尝试过将其移动到
的顶部?我尝试过,我发现此错误无法设置null的属性'innerHTML'目的是从子级执行js,而不是从父级执行js。我更新了帖子,您能看到吗?我尝试过,我收到此错误无法设置null的属性'innerHTML'您的代码document.getElementById(“frame”)
返回null,因为此idI没有要获取的帧(元素)添加了missig代码/元素(以及更多)到代码段!我想要的是,当我打开父页面时,如果我单击按钮,iframe应该被删除。这应该是父页面还是子页面?我尝试过了,我得到了这个错误,无法设置null的属性“innerHTML”。您的代码文档。getElementById(“frame”)
返回null,因为没有框架(元素)为了通过此idI,我在代码段中添加了missig代码/元素(以及更多内容)!我想要的是,当我打开父页面时,如果我单击按钮,iframe应该被删除。这应该是父页面还是子页面?